Mexico - Hospital Discharges for Alzheimer's Disease Cases

Since 2014, Mexico Hospital Discharges for Alzheimer's Disease Cases decreased by 2.7% year on year. At 279.5 Hospital Discharges in 2019, the country was number 23 comparing other countries in Hospital Discharges for Alzheimer's Disease Cases. Mexico is overtaken by Slovakia, which was number 22 with 298 Hospital Discharges and is followed by Netherlands with 215 Hospital Discharges. Germany, United Kingdom and Turkey resp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. South Korea recorded the best 5 years average growth at +11.9% per year, while Costa Rica was the worst growing country at -19.7% per year.
